Wind & warmth gobble it up

The snow pack disappears by this afternoon as mild air gobbles up most of the snow on the ground with some powerful SW winds.  Skies will become partly cloudy, winds will gust to 25 MPH and highs max out in the mid 40's - a good 10 degrees above seasonal norms.

Overnight skies will be partly cloudy with more seasonable lows dropping into the mid 20's.  After a sunny start Friday morning - clouds will be on the increase throughout the day with showers developing towards evening.  Highs will be near 40 degrees.

Friday kicks off the weekend in style with sunshine breaking out after some early morning showers.  Highs will climb into the low and mid 50's.  Saturday is definitely the pick of the weekend with some sun and highs climbing to near 60 degrees... that's nearly 25 degrees above normal for this time of year!

Sunday the storm that will bring the warm run to an end moves in with scattered showers and a dramatic cool down.  By Monday expect highs in the lower 30's with scattered snow showers.

Enjoy the taste of spring headed our way!
